Area CEOs of small and mid-sized companies still optimistic, but trade tariffs cause some worry (Richmond Times-Dispatch)

July 12, 2018

Top executives with small- and medium-size companies in central Virginia remain mostly positive about the economy, but trade tariffs imposed by the Trump administration are causing some worry, according to a recent survey.

About half of the chief executive officers who responded to a recent economic outlook survey by the Virginia Council of CEOs and the University of Richmond said they expect to see a “somewhat negative impact” as a result of tariffs. About 6 percent expect a “large negative impact.”
